Gradio Notebook in Hugging Face Spaces

Javier Calderon Jr
4 min readFeb 15, 2024

--

Introduction

The quest for more accessible, interactive, and collaborative tools has led to the creation of Gradio Notebook. This groundbreaking innovation transforms the way developers and researchers interact with AI models, making it simpler to deploy, share, and experiment with interactive notebook user experiences directly on Hugging Face Spaces. Gradio Notebook emerges as a beacon of innovation, streamlining the bridge between complex AI models and user-friendly interfaces.

The Genesis of Gradio Notebook

Gradio Notebook is not just a tool; it’s a paradigm shift in AI model interaction and presentation. Developed by Lastmile AI, this custom component leverages the power and flexibility of Hugging Face Spaces, a platform known for its extensive repository of machine learning models and datasets. The Gradio Notebook template, available on GitHub, and its detailed documentation on the Lastmile AI dev site, serve as the foundation for deploying interactive notebooks that breathe life into static models with dynamic, engaging UX elements.

  1. Interactive Notebook UX on Hugging Face Spaces: Gradio Notebook introduces an interactive notebook user experience that integrates seamlessly with Hugging Face Spaces. This feature allows developers to create and share live demos of their AI models without the need for extensive web development skills. Users can interact with the models in real-time, tweaking inputs to see outputs instantaneously, which significantly enhances understanding and engagement.
  2. Ease of Deployment: The simplicity of deploying a Gradio Notebook is one of its standout features. With just a few clicks, researchers and developers can bring their models to a broader audience. This ease of deployment democratizes access to AI technologies, enabling individuals and teams of all sizes to showcase their work on a global stage.
  3. Collaboration and Sharing: Collaboration is at the heart of innovation. Gradio Notebook fosters a collaborative environment by making it easy for users to share their interactive notebooks. Whether it’s for educational purposes, research collaboration, or gathering feedback from the community, this tool facilitates a more connected AI ecosystem.
  4. Extensible and Customizable: Flexibility is key in the world of AI and machine learning. Gradio Notebook is designed to be both extensible and customizable, allowing developers to tailor the interface and functionality to their specific needs. This adaptability ensures that a wide range of projects, from simple demonstrations to complex interactive tutorials, can be accommodated.
  5. Enhanced Accessibility and Engagement: By transforming static models into interactive experiences, Gradio Notebook significantly enhances accessibility and engagement. This approach lowers the barriers to entry for non-experts, making AI more approachable and understandable to a broader audience.

Conclusion

Gradio Notebook stands as a testament to the power of innovation in making AI more accessible, interactive, and collaborative. Its integration into Hugging Face Spaces opens up new avenues for sharing and engaging with AI models, breaking down barriers and fostering a community of shared knowledge and exploration. As we look to the future, the potential of Gradio Notebook to revolutionize the way we interact with AI is boundless. It invites us to imagine a world where AI is not just a tool for the few but a shared resource that empowers everyone to contribute to the tapestry of technological advancement. The journey of Gradio Notebook is just beginning, and its impact on the AI community will undoubtedly be profound and enduring.

--

--

Javier Calderon Jr

CTO, Tech Entrepreneur, Mad Scientist, that has a passion to Innovate Solutions that specializes in Web3, Artificial Intelligence, and Cyber Security